  • Title

    Modeling and simulation of VDL Mode 3 subnetwork in the en route and terminal domains

  • Abstract
    Presents the recent modeling and simulation of the International Civil Aviation Organization (ICAO) very high frequency (VHF) digital link (VDL) Mode 3 subnetwork in an Aeronautical Telecommunication Network (ATN) environment for the en route and terminal domains. This was conducted to study the performance of this subnetwork under various aircraft and application traffic loading conditions. Important questions to be answered include the connection and data transfer delays
